Preparing equipment and checking network compatibility
Before starting the configuration process, you need to ensure that your network equipment and the printer itself are ready to communicate. Make sure your wireless router is working properly and is assigning IP addresses to devices within the range. 2.4 GHzIt is important to note that many budget laser printer models, including Pantum M6500W, may not support modern standard networks 5 GHz, so having a working 2.4 GHz network is a must.
Place the printer in a strong signal area, close to the router, during setup. This will minimize the risk of data packet loss during the initial encryption key exchange. If the device has been used before, we recommend resetting the network settings to factory defaults to avoid conflicts with old connection profiles.
⚠️ Attention: Make sure that AP Isolation is not enabled on your router, as this feature prevents devices on the same network from communicating with each other, making printing impossible.
Check that your computer has a USB port, as initial Wi-Fi setup often requires a temporary wired connection. Drivers must be compatible with your operating system, whether Windows 10/11 or macOSHaving the latest firmware version can also impact connection stability, although this isn't always critical for basic setup.
Quick setup method via WPS button
The easiest and fastest way to connect Pantum M6500W to a wireless network is the use of technology WPS (Wi-Fi Protected Setup). This method allows you to transfer network parameters (SSID and password) automatically, eliminating the need to manually enter them through the printer's control panel. First, make sure your router supports this feature and it's enabled.
Press and hold the button WPS on your router for a few seconds until the indicator light starts blinking. Immediately after that, go to the printer and press the button Wi-Fi on the control panel. On some models, you may need to hold the Wi-Fi button until the wireless network indicator starts blinking rapidly, indicating search mode.
The device will automatically attempt to find an active WPS signal and establish a secure connection. If successful, the printer's Wi-Fi indicator will turn solid, indicating it has successfully acquired an IP address and is ready to print. This method is especially convenient if you don't know your Wi-Fi network password or don't want to enter it manually.
- 📶 Make sure the router is within 3-5 meters of the printer for a stable handshake.
- 🔒 The WPS method only works if the appropriate security protocol (usually WPA2) is enabled on the router.
- ⏱️ The time interval between pressing the button on the router and on the printer should not exceed 2 minutes.
Please note that some internet providers or router models may limit the number of devices that can connect via WPS. If automatic connection fails on the first try, repeat the process after rebooting both devices. In rare cases, a firmware update for the printer itself may be required to ensure proper operation with new encryption standards.
Setting up Wi-Fi via USB cable and computer
If automatic methods don't work, the most reliable option is to use an installation disc or a driver package downloaded from the official website. Run the installation file. Setup.exe and follow the setup wizard's instructions. When the program prompts you to select a connection type, select Wireless connection (Wireless Network).
During the installation process, the program will ask you to temporarily connect the printer to your computer via a USB cable. This is necessary so the installer can transfer the network settings (network name and password) directly to the printer's Wi-Fi module. Follow the on-screen prompts, selecting your network from the list of available connections.
Sequence of actions in the installation wizard:1. Launch the Pantum installer.
2. Selecting the language and accepting the license agreement.
3. Select connection type: Wireless Network.
4. Confirm USB cable connection.
5. Enter the Wi-Fi password (if it is not selected automatically).
6. Wait for the message "Setup complete".
After successfully transferring the parameters, the printer will disconnect from the USB port and enter network standby mode. The Wi-Fi indicator should light, confirming successful registration with the network. The computer may temporarily lose connection with the device at this point, which is normal behavior when switching interfaces.

It's important not to remove the USB cable until the installer explicitly informs you that configuration is complete. Disconnecting it prematurely may prevent your settings from being saved to the device's non-volatile memory. If installation is successful, you can uninstall the setup software, leaving only the essential print drivers.
Using the Pantum Mobile Print app
For users of mobile devices based on Android And iOS The manufacturer offers a specialized application Pantum Mobile PrintThis tool not only allows you to print documents but also perform initial setup of the printer's Wi-Fi module directly from your smartphone. Download the app from the official store (Google Play or App Store) and launch it.
When you first launch the app, it will ask for location and local network access permissions, which are necessary to detect printers within range. Select the option to add a new device and follow the on-screen instructions. The app will prompt you to select your Wi-Fi network from the list and enter the password, after which your phone will transmit this information to the printer.

Using the mobile app is especially convenient when you don't have a computer with a disc drive or USB port. The app's functionality is constantly updated, adding support for new file formats and cloud services. Once successfully set up via your phone, the printer becomes accessible to all other devices on the same network.
⚠️ Attention: For the app to work correctly on Android versions 10 and above, you need to allow access to "Precise Location" because Android system restrictions use geolocation to scan Wi-Fi networks.
Wi-Fi Direct connection
Technology Wi-Fi Direct Allows you to connect your computer or smartphone directly to the printer, bypassing your home router. This creates a direct wireless connection between the two devices, making it ideal for printing documents when visiting or in the office, where access to the main network is limited or prohibited.
To activate this mode on the control panel Pantum M6500W You need to press and hold the Wi-Fi Direct button (or the button combination specified in the instructions) until the corresponding indicator lights up. The printer will begin broadcasting its own network, the name of which usually contains the device model, for example, Pantum-M6500W-XXXX.
Find this network in the list of available connections on your phone or laptop. To connect, you'll need to enter a password, which by default is often a combination of numbers or can be found on a sticker on the back of the device. Once connected, you can print documents just as you would over a regular network.
- 📱 Ideal for printing from devices that don't have access to corporate Wi-Fi.
- 🔒 The connection is protected by a password, which can be changed through the printer's web interface.
- 📉 Data transfer speed may be lower than through a full-fledged router due to the characteristics of single-channel communication.
Please note that when connecting via Wi-Fi Direct, your mobile device may temporarily lose internet access as it switches to the printer's local network. Some modern smartphones support simultaneous operation on both networks, but this depends on the specific hardware and OS version.
How to change Wi-Fi Direct password?
To change the password, log in to the printer's web interface using a browser and enter its IP address. Under Network Settings -> Wi-Fi Direct, you can set a new PIN to protect the connection from unauthorized access.
Diagnostics and problem solving
Even if you carefully follow the instructions, situations may arise when the printer Pantum M6500W won't connect to the network or loses connection. Often the problem lies in the router's security settings, such as filtering MAC addressesIf the router has a whitelist enabled, you need to find the printer's MAC address (by printing a configuration report) and add it to the allowed list.
Another common cause is a frequency range mismatch. As mentioned earlier, the printer operates in a range 2.4 GHzIf your router broadcasts one network with a common name (Smart Connect) for both ranges, try temporarily separating them MyWiFi_2.4 And MyWiFi_5 in the router settings and connect to the first one.
If the Wi-Fi indicator is blinking but the connection fails, try assigning a static IP address. This can be done from the printer control panel by accessing the network menu. Make sure the selected IP address is in the same subnet as your computer but does not overlap with any addresses assigned by the DHCP server.
If the wireless module is completely inoperable, you may need to reset the network settings to factory defaults. This is usually done by holding down the cancel button or using a special key combination when turning on the device. After the reset, you will have to repeat the setup procedure.
Why doesn't the printer see the Wi-Fi network?
The most common cause is that the router only operates in 5 GHz mode or uses an encryption standard not supported by the printer (e.g., WPA3-only). Try enabling mixed WPA2/WPA3 mode and ensure that the 2.4 GHz network is active.
How to find the IP address of a Pantum printer?
The fastest way is to print a configuration report. Press the "Stop/Reset" button three times quickly or hold the Wi-Fi button for 10 seconds (depending on the firmware version) to get a page with the current network parameters, including the IP address.
Is it possible to connect a printer to a hidden network (Hidden SSID)?
Yes, but automatic detection won't work. You'll need to use the USB cable setup method and manually enter the network name (SSID) exactly, including capitalization, as the printer won't be able to "see" it when scanning.
What to do if the red Wi-Fi light is on?
Red usually indicates a connection error or low signal strength. Check your password, make sure your router isn't blocking the device, and try moving the printer closer to the signal source.
